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ast
Tucked into a stately, history-rich Montford neighbourhood within walking distance of downtown Asheville, the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ast charms guests with beautifully appointed rooms, gourmet breakfasts that feel like a special restaurant experience each morning, homemade cookies on arrival, and the warmly attentive hosting of Alicia, though at least one prospective guest found her manner over the telephone rather less welcoming.

Frequently asked questions
- Where is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ast located?
- Black Walnut is in a quiet, historical neighbourhood just north of downtown Asheville, within walking distance of restaurants and Montford Park. You can easily stroll to downtown or drive there in minutes.
- How cosy is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ast?
- Black Walnut scores 6.6 out of 10 for cosiness, guests consistently praise its comfortable rooms, beautiful décor, and intimate atmosphere that makes you feel genuinely welcomed and at home.
- Is the breakfast good at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ast?
- Yes, breakfast is a genuine highlight. Guests rave about the delicious, thoughtfully prepared meals; the owner puts real care into each one, and visitors consistently rate the breakfasts as exceptional.
- Is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ast good for couples?
- Absolutely. Guests describe rooms like the Sunshine Room as romantic and cosy, and couples appreciate the intimate, beautifully decorated setting and attentive hospitality that makes stays feel special and meaningful.
- What's the service like at Black Walnut Bed & Breakfast?
- The owners, Alicia and Celeste, are genuinely warm and attentive from arrival onwards. Guests feel an instant sense of relaxation and say the sisters' familiarity and kindness make you feel you've known them for years.
